[shakedown 1979, cool kids never have the time on a live wire right up off the street you and i should meet junebug skipping like a stone with the headlights pointed at the dawn] = living life as a teenager, doing teenage things, seeking out bf/gf, living life careless and free, hanging out with friends etc. [we were sure we'd never see an end to it all and i don't even care to shake these zipper blues and we don't know just where our bones will rest to dust i guess forgotten and absorbed into the earth below] = never considered the fact that one day this will all end, [double cross the vacant and the bored they're not sure just what we have in the store morphine city slippin dues down to see that we don't even care as restless as we are] =living life careless and free(vacent and the bored), teenagers start to experiment(not sure wat we have in store, morphine city..) [we feel the pull in the land of a thousand guilts and poured cement, lamented and assured to the lights and towns below] = as assured experiementation with drugs causes a bad event to happen, guilt follows etc. [faster than the speed of sound faster than we thought we'd go, beneath the sound of hope justine never knew the rules, hung down with the freaks and the ghouls] =faster than they considered a (justine's) life ends to drugs(never knew the rules, hung with freaks and ghouls) [no apologies ever need be made, i know you better than you fake it to see that we don't care to shake these zipper blues and we don't know just where our bones will rest to dust i guess forgotten and absorbed into the earth below] =a life ends (justines) no body learns from this(to see that we dont to shake zipper blues) [the street heats the urgency of sound as you can see there's no one around] = teenage life (the streets) needs guidence and help etc. doesnt happen ( you can see no one around) |
